Career Roles and Key Responsibilities in Advanced Energy Storage

Career Role Key Responsibilities
Energy Storage Engineer Design and optimize energy storage systems
Conduct performance testing and analysis
Develop innovative storage solutions
Battery Research Scientist Research new battery materials and chemistries
Improve energy density and lifecycle
Collaborate on R&D projects
Energy Systems Analyst Model and simulate energy storage systems
Analyze grid integration and efficiency
Provide data-driven insights
Project Manager Oversee energy storage project execution
Manage budgets and timelines
Coordinate cross-functional teams
Policy and Regulatory Advisor Advise on energy storage policies
Ensure compliance with regulations
Engage with stakeholders and policymakers
Technical Sales Engineer Promote energy storage solutions
Provide technical support to clients
Develop sales strategies
Sustainability Consultant Assess environmental impact of storage systems
Recommend sustainable practices
Support green energy initiatives
